Hello! Sorry if my english is bad cuz my mother tongue is french. I have a question: I have learned that k800's video are bad, but I don't know if it's just videos taken by k800 or if even a video was good it will be badly displayed by k800? This message was posted from a Nokia

The actual video record itself is of bad quality...qcif recording...it's just poor..and thats it...however, it can playback converted file formats in some excellent quality...film's etc...it's not something that bother's me, because i knew all about the phone before i go it...the video's a fun thing..thats it.

As said it's only the video recording feature that is as bad as the K750 etc. The video viewing is on the other hand very good. You can play it in full resolution and quite high bitrate. On the fantastic K800i screen it looks beutiful.
